{
"event": "PreToolUse",
"tool_name": "Bash",
"tool_input": {
"command": "grep -A 20 \"def chunk_pdf\" \/var\/www\/scripts\/pipeline\/chunk.py",
"description": "Check chunk_pdf function"
}
}
{
"tool_response": {
"stdout": "def chunk_pdf(pages):\n \"\"\"Chunk PDF by pages and paragraphs.\"\"\"\n chunks = []\n position = 0\n\n for page in pages:\n if not page[\"text\"]:\n continue\n\n # Split page into paragraphs\n paragraphs = page[\"text\"].split(\"\\n\\n\")\n\n current_chunk = []\n current_size = 0\n\n for para in paragraphs:\n para = para.strip()\n if not para:\n continue\n\n para_size = len(para)",
"stderr": "",
"interrupted": false,
"isImage": false
}
}